Trios 3 is the best and fastest intra oral scanner by far.
The advanced software will enhance the efficiency of scanning a palate which is crucial.
Medit I500 is crap at speed scanning and will leave voids and artifacts which are a pita.Trios bite scan alignment is far superior to Medit as well.
You will overpay if you lease.

I see around 100 scans a day. In terms of scan quality only, my take is Trios>Itero>Medit>Primescan>Carestream/Dexis. With Trios being FAR superior to the others.
